Output d44597fc4b7b1d6e87d021f23b7389441ec269d72dc667f0157ea239892b8a4e:0

value
2556136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3189b211cd33b640540cc9a8400a9e82bf2e0fa OP_EQUAL
address
3PrPbp2T1q3f4GX4H3n7yCELHiSFNfozr8
transaction
d44597fc4b7b1d6e87d021f23b7389441ec269d72dc667f0157ea239892b8a4e
confirmations
185396
spent
true